**Handover: Orphan sweeper (Tidewrack)**

Welcome. Tidewrack runs hourly in the Saltfen environment, scanning for orphaned resources — detached volumes, unreferenced snapshots, dangling load balancers — and tags them for a 72-hour grace period before deletion. The allowlist lives in `sweeper/config`; add entries there for anything long-lived. Deletion logs go to the audit bucket. One gotcha: the bucket's encryption keys sit in a sealed store, and reviewing old logs means unsealing it. For that, use the passphrase below.

vault phrase of bawep-tafop = wendor-silael-julwyn-pelox-kasion-oliox-ralax

## Authentication

Heads up: the nightly reindex job (`reindex_nightly.py`) talks to the Lanternfish search cluster, and that cluster won't accept anonymous writes anymore — we locked it down last sprint. The job now authenticates as the `reindex-runner` service identity against Corvid Gateway, and the token is injected via the `LF_INDEX_TOKEN` env var in the scheduler config. Nothing clever going on, just a bearer header on every batch request. For review purposes, the staging credential currently in use is listed below.

service key, kadug-kadup: kto15_rN23XLAYImmZgrJ

Subject: Key rotation for the cron drift investigation

Hi folks — welcome aboard! While digging into the clock drift on the Tarnwick cron fleet, we realized the old Pulsegate key had been shared a bit too widely, so we rotated it. Nothing broke, but please update your local configs before tomorrow's standup. The new key for the drift-collector endpoint is right here.

gateway credential: kto23_LX9A4ys6i4nzHtpOLNLodKK